Output d2debfa2b5490bba6612d27d187334c089325e86e1d7ba52253bd5f3c1d34afe:2

value
308500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8677b57f6bc212a90dc0331b0719c3c6343498 OP_EQUAL
address
35w26Lm6UFdsnvUygNsEpYeAM87heX7o5X
transaction
d2debfa2b5490bba6612d27d187334c089325e86e1d7ba52253bd5f3c1d34afe
spent
true